IN
Positive Supply Voltage. Connect IN to the positive side of the input voltage. Bypass IN
with a 10µF capacitor to GND.
Shutdown Input. Drive SHDN low to force GATE low and turn off the external n-channel

Gate-Driver Output. Connect GATE to the gate of the external n-channel MOSFET switch.
5
6
6
6
GATE
GATE is the output of a charge pump with a 100µA pullup current to 10V (typ) above IN
during normal operation. GATE is quickly clamped to OUTFB during an overvoltage
condition. GATE pulls low when SHDN is low.

OUTFB Output-Voltage-Sense Input. Connect OUTFB to the source of the external n-channel
MOSFET switch.
p-Channel Gate-Driver Output. Connect GATEP to the gate of an external p-channel
MOSFET to provide low-drop reverse-voltage protection. GATEP is biased to ensure that

Power-OK Output. POK is an open-drain output. POK remains low while POKSET is
below the internal POKSET threshold. POK goes high impedance when POKSET goes
above the internal POKSET threshold. Connect POK to an external pullup resistor.
Power-OK Threshold-Adjustment Input. POK remains low while POKSET is below the

UVSET
Undervoltage-Threshold Adjustment Input. Connect UVSET to an external resistive
voltage-divider network to adjust the desired undervoltage threshold.
